To Have and to Hold by Eric Bennett

Tucker[i] adores[ii] Alina[iii].
________________________________________
[i] Licensed undertaker.
[ii] Poses the face: closes the mouth, stitches the lips together, pulls the lids down. If the eyes aren’t closed they gape open and since they’re composed primarily of water, the eyes tend to dehydrate and sink detracting from the appearance.
[iii] Cadaver.
